“Influences Let's see how art insisted on crossing my path, becoming my passion. "THE MEDICAL FUTURE" It is difficult to talk about influences because I was not the typical one who went to museums or that he had artist or architect parents. In my case, I was going to be a doctor. My supplies at hand were anatomy books that my mom had saved for me since high school. And despite everything, this helped me because it had illustrations and diagrams, for me they were very beautiful, they had textures, they had colors and they were very striking, what I liked was seeing the images, seeing the body...”

Álvaro Cardozo is an illustrator from Bogotá, Colombia who invested his time and effort into becoming a digital illustrator, despite initially studying graphic design. After successfully carrying out his first illustration project at university, he was contracted by an animation studio to join their production team, designing scenes, characters, props, and storyboards, until he was eventually promoted to an Art Director position.
He began his freelance career in 2014. Since then, he has worked with advertising agencies, production studios, video game studios, and authors on a range of international projects. His client portfolio includes video game and animation studios like Skew Studio in the UK, Oruga Touching Dreams, and Autobotika, as well as editorial work for Penguin Random House and independent writers.
